Please refrain from sending general inquiries to the below addresses for matters which can be addressed through the website in their designated areas. For Example, do not email registrar asking if you can register without first checking the registration page and following the information presented there.

Name, Position, Email Board

Krista Thompson
Head Coach

[email protected]


2022/2023 Assistant coaches include Everett Yee, Noah Elbaz and Declan Roberts

Eva Chuen
[email protected]

Yes Contact for withdrawals and non routing registration issues
Eva joined the board for 2022/2023 season

J.C. Barrows
[email protected]      

Yes Joined the board for 2022/2023 season

Anthony Nguyen Sturm
[email protected]


Joined the board for the 2020/2021 season and was interim president for 2021/2022 season

Vince Mok   
Brand & Apparel 
[email protected]

Yes Joined the board for the 2022/2023 season and continues to serve

Jamie Gair/Ashley Sumner
Social Director
[email protected]


Jamie joined the board for the 2020/2021 season and continues to serve

Paige Hunter
[email protected] 


Paige joined board for the 2022/2023 season 

Lori Clements
Volunteer Coordinator
[email protected]


Yes Lori moved from Social Coordinator to Volunteer Coordinator for the 2022/2023 season

Meet Manager


We are always looking to add to the team that sits on the board if you have a desire to help make the club the best it can be please email any of the current board members and offer your help.